Transaction 82dddfdf3310813ca4d9bc82bb6c56b5ca5dccc6e3ae90afbb464079f256613c

11 Input
2 Outputs
  • 82dddfdf3310813ca4d9bc82bb6c56b5ca5dccc6e3ae90afbb464079f256613c:0
  • value  1150750000
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h
  • 82dddfdf3310813ca4d9bc82bb6c56b5ca5dccc6e3ae90afbb464079f256613c:1
  • value  42979269
    address  31s9z3oaq8WHxJ1t49PiZs5vTrVZHpmGMi